This article was previously published under Q320778
This article has been archived. It is offered "as is" and will no longer be updated.
The previously released download for MDAC 2.7 has been replaced with the MDAC 2.7 Refresh. Although no code changes have been made to the components in the MDAC 2.7 Refresh from MDAC 2.7, the MDAC 2.7 Refresh contains changes to the way the builds are organized and versioned, which corrects existing issues with the MDAC 2.7 installation. The most important change to remember when you install the MDAC 2.7 Refresh is that the version numbers of most components in the stack have been changed, as described in this article.
The MDAC 2.7 Refresh has been released primarily to address the issue that is described in the following Microsoft Knowledge Base article:
314755 BUG: Error When You Install MDAC 2.7 After MDAC 2.6 SP2
Because no coding changes have been made to any of the MDAC components from MDAC 2.7 to the MDAC 2.7 Refresh, a program that is tested against MDAC 2.7 should function and perform identically to a program that is tested against the MDAC 2.7 Refresh.
The primary change in the MDAC 2.7 Refresh is that the version numbers of most of the files that are included with MDAC have been updated. MDAC components are versioned in four parts, as follows:
[major version number].[minor version number].[build number].[revision]
For MDAC 2.7, the major version number is 2 and the minor version number is 70. These numbers are the same in the MDAC 2.7 Refresh. However, the build number for most files is now 9001, and the revision number is 0. Therefore, most of the files in the MDAC 2.7 Refresh have the following full versioning:
The files affected by these changes are those that are made up of the MDAC core as follows:
Open Database Connectivity (ODBC)
ActiveX Data Objects (ADO)
All Microsoft SQL Server interfaces, including the following:
OLE DB provider
To download MDAC 2.7, see the following Microsoft Web site: